Carpal Tunnel Syndrome (CTS) is a condition caused by compression of the median nerve as it passes through the carpal tunnel, a narrow passageway in the wrist. This compression can lead to a range of uncomfortable symptoms, including pain, numbness, and tingling in the thumb, index finger, middle finger, and part of the ring finger. It can also cause weakness in the hand, making it difficult to perform everyday tasks like gripping objects, typing, or even sleeping comfortably. While severe cases may eventually require surgical intervention, many individuals can find significant relief through conservative, non-surgical treatments. Comprehensive Assessment and Diagnosis: A thorough evaluation of your symptoms, medical history, and physical examination to accurately diagnose Carpal Tunnel Syndrome and rule out other conditions that may mimic its symptoms. This often includes specific tests to assess nerve function.
Chiropractic Adjustments (as applicable to upper extremities): While chiropractors are known for spinal adjustments, they also perform adjustments to extremities. In the context of CTS, this could involve gentle adjustments to the wrist, elbow, or even the neck and upper back if those areas are contributing to nerve irritation or compression of the median nerve.
Soft Tissue Mobilization: Techniques applied to the muscles, tendons, and ligaments in the wrist, forearm, and hand to reduce tension, improve circulation, and release adhesions that may be contributing to nerve compression. This can include specialized massage or manual therapy.
Therapeutic Exercises: Prescription of specific exercises designed to strengthen the muscles of the hand and forearm, improve flexibility, and enhance nerve gliding within the carpal tunnel. These exercises are crucial for long-term relief and prevention of recurrence.
Ergonomic Counseling: Guidance on adjusting workspaces, posture, and daily activities to minimize repetitive strain and reduce pressure on the median nerve. This is a critical component for preventing exacerbation and recurrence of CTS.
Splinting and Bracing Recommendations: Advice on proper splinting or bracing, especially during sleep, to keep the wrist in a neutral position, thereby reducing pressure on the median nerve and alleviating nocturnal symptoms.
Modalities for Pain and Inflammation: Application of various physical therapy modalities such as cold therapy, heat therapy, or potentially electrical stimulation to help reduce pain and inflammation in the affected area, providing symptomatic relief.
